The difference between a money bill and a ordinary bill is: An Ordinary Bill can be introduced in any of the Houses of the Parliament while A Money Bill can only be introduced in the Lok Sabha and cannot be introduced in Rajya Sabha.

A bill can be introduced in the legislative process in either the House of Representatives or the Senate.
After a bill is introduced in either the House or the Senate, the bill is assigned a number.
